R. - Foiles Pit # 79-210 <br />Dear Sir: <br />Morgan County is requesting a technical revision of the above <br />mentioned open gravel pit. The material is used for public roads in <br />Morgan County. <br />2.93 acres of the mined area has already been reclaimed. The 5.2 <br />acres is partially mined. The problem encountered is the boundary <br />line on the easterly side being located on the top of the hill to be <br />mined creating a problem with the 5.1 slope in the reclamation plan. <br />By extending the east boundary line approximately 300 feet to the <br />northeast as shown on the attached drawing Exhibit C, there will be a <br />more natural 5.1 slope on the east boundary as shown on aerial map <br />marked Exhibit D. By this move more material will be utilized and <br />minimize the expense of reclamation. With this technical revision the <br />pit acres is 9.88. <br />If additional information is required please contact Robert Samples <br />970-842-5671, Mailing Address 25949 Rd.
